Eligibility Criteria to manage Transfer Requests

Before initiating a transfer request, it’s crucial to understand the eligibility requirements set by the Public Service Management and Good Governance of Tanzania. Government recently introduced new rules for transfers for public servants in rural and remote areas:

Minimum Service Period

Public servants must have completed a minimum of four years (48 months) in their current position before being eligible to apply for a transfer. This policy ensures stability and adequate service delivery in various departments .

Valid Reasons for Transfer

Transfers are typically considered for reasons such as:

  • Medical conditions
  • Family reunification
  • Career development opportunities
  • Administrative restructuring

It’s essential to provide appropriate documentation to support the transfer request, depending on the reason cited.

Step-by-Step Guide to Manage Transfer in the ESS Utumishi Portal

Managing transfers through the ESS Utumishi portal involves a systematic process. Here’s a step-by-step guide:

Step 1. Visit the Portal

Visit the official ESS Utumishi portal through this link: https://ess.utumishi.go.tz/sessions/signin. Log in using your Check Number as the username and your password. Now visit your dashboard.

ESS Utumishi Portal

Step 2. Navigate to the Transfer Management Section

After accessing your dashboard, locate and click on the “Transfer Management” tab. This section allows you to view existing transfer requests and initiate new ones.

e-Uhamisho

Step 3. Transfer Request

By clicking on Manage transfers a new window will open. It contains 4 action buttons: Transfer requests, Vacancy Requests, Incoming Exchange Request and Own Exchange Requests.
To initiate a new transfer click on “Transfer Requests

Transfer Requests

Here you can: 

  • Create Transfer

Click on Create transfer, a new pop up will appear on the screen showing following details:

  • From: Here select region from where you are moving. 
  • To Region: Select region where you want to be transferred. 
  • Check Boxes: Not under local Government and CV attachment box.
  • Mobile Number: Add your registered mobile Number.
  • Select Reason: Select reason for your transfer in this box such as medical reasons.
Create Transfer Request

After filling these details Click on Save option to save in your directory. 

Submit the Transfer Request

  • Review all entered information for accuracy.
  • Click “Submit” to forward your request to the relevant authorities for consideration
Submit Transfer Request

Track the Status of Your Transfer Request

After submission, you can monitor the progress of your request within the “Transfer Management” section. Statuses may include:

  • Pending: Awaiting review.
  • Under Review: Being evaluated by the relevant department.
  • Approved: Transfer request accepted.
  • Rejected: Transfer request denied, with reasons provided.

Best Practices for a Successful Transfer Request

To enhance the likelihood of your transfer request being approved, read following instructions carefully:

  • Ensure Eligibility: Confirm that you meet the minimum service period (4 years) and other criteria before applying.
  • Provide Comprehensive Documentation: Attach all necessary supporting documents to validate your reason for transfer.
  • Maintain Clear Communication: Use the portal’s messaging features to communicate with HR personnel, if needed.
  • Monitor Regularly: Keep an eye on your request’s status and respond promptly to any additional information requests.

Create Vacancies in ESS Utumishi Portal

This function allows government institutions to post internal and external job openings, helping attract qualified candidates in a centralized and transparent manner.

  • Click on Manage Transfers. After opening a new window, click on the Vacancy Requests. 
  • Tap Create Vacancy! Enter demanded details such as workstation, Reason, Email Address and Mobile Number
  • Never forget to attach a CV. 
  • Then Submit your vacancy for approval.

Accept Transfer Exchange Request

In the Tanzanian public service system, a transfer exchange request allows two employees from different locations or departments to swap duty stations by mutual agreement.

This process is especially useful for civil servants looking to relocate without disrupting departmental needs. Through the Portal, managing and accepting such requests is now faster, more transparent, and entirely online.

Create Own Transfer Exchange Request

Rather than waiting for vacancies, you can create a transfer exchange request and connect with other employees who may be interested in swapping positions.

This self-initiated option gives you control over your career movement, provided you meet the eligibility requirements and both parties are willing to proceed.
